Identifying the Signs of a Plateau and Understanding Its Root Causes
Reaching a plateau in your fitness journey can feel frustrating and demotivating, but recognizing its signs is crucial for overcoming it. Common indicators include stagnation in progress—where you no longer see improvements in strength, endurance, or weight loss—and a sense of boredom with your routine. Other physical signs may include feelings of fatigue during workouts or an increase in perceived exertion, where activities that previously felt manageable suddenly feel much more difficult.
Understanding the root causes of these plateaus often requires a closer look at both your training regimen and lifestyle. Factors contributing to a plateau may include insufficient recovery periods, inadequate nutrition, or an overly rigid routine that lacks variation. Addressing these issues can revive your motivation and spark progress once again. Here are a few common root causes:
- Overtraining: Not allowing your body the necessary time to recover.
- Nutrition Gaps: Failing to meet your dietary needs, which can sap energy and hinder performance.
- Monotony: Sticking to the same workouts, which can lead to stagnation.
Innovative Techniques to Revitalize Your Workouts and Boost Motivation
Revitalizing your workouts doesn’t always mean changing your entire routine. Sometimes, it’s the small tweaks that can reignite your motivation and energy levels. Consider incorporating circuit training into your sessions; it keeps your heart rate up and can be easily customized to tackle specific muscle groups. Additionally, try setting up mini-challenges for yourself or with a workout buddy—these could be as simple as increasing the number of reps each week or timing your sets to encourage a little friendly competition.
Another innovative approach is to explore cross-training, which not only helps prevent burnout but also enhances your overall fitness capabilities. Activities like yoga, Pilates, or even dance can provide an enjoyable break from your usual regimen while still contributing to your physical goals. Additionally, listen to your body and don’t shy away from scheduling active recovery days—these can be crucial for muscle repair and can involve light activities like walking or swimming. Just remember to embrace variety; keep your workouts fresh and engaging.
Nourishing Your Body: Dietary Adjustments to Overcome Stagnation
To invigorate your body and dismantle the barriers of stagnation, making thoughtful dietary adjustments is essential. Start by incorporating a variety of colors on your plate; each hue represents different nutrients and antioxidants vital for overall wellness. This not only enhances the visual appeal of your meals but also ensures you’re getting a broad spectrum of beneficial compounds. Additionally, consider introducing high-fiber foods, such as whole grains, legumes, and fresh fruits. Fiber is not only vital for digestive health but can also aid in controlling hunger and improving metabolic rates.
Another powerful tweak is increasing your protein intake. Protein is crucial for muscle repair and growth, which can be particularly beneficial if you’re hitting a plateau. Opt for lean sources like chicken, fish, tofu, and legumes. Moreover, stay hydrated, as often we mistake thirst for hunger, leading to unnecessary snacking.
